Research on application of graph technology in vocational education: case study of medical aesthetics technology major

Abstract: With the development of big data and information technology,the application of knowledge graphs,ability graphs and quality graphs in vocational education is becoming increasingly widespread. Taking the medical aesthetics technology major as an example,this paper investigated industry demands,collected and analyzed data,and applied information technology to construct knowledge graphs,ability graphs,and quality graphs. These graphs play an important role in optimizing talent training programs,reconstructing curriculum systems,developing digital and intelligent teaching resources,reforming teaching models,and innovating teaching evaluation. Practice shows that the application of graph technology has effectively driven the digital transformation of vocational education. It not only improves the accuracy of teaching but also promotes in-depth alignment between talent cultivation and industry demands,providing strong support for the high-quality development of the industry.
